A local rider/racer was cleaned out. All her bikes were taken from her garage and from what they took as apposed to what they left they seemed knowledgeable about bikes. The following are descriptions she posted on another site. If you see any of them or hear of them you can contact me via pm or email link and I will get the info to her.

"ALL my bikes were stolen from my garage last night! If anybody sees any of the following bikes on the market anywhere, please let me know!!!

2004 small Kona Stab Primo - 888 fork, romic shock with ti spring, XT Brakes, chris king front hub, tubeless wheels, STG I-beam seat and seat post, ringle rear hub (only about 2 small Kona Stab Primos were distributed this year, so if you see one being sold, it's probably the bike);

2003 small Kona Stinky Dee Lux - upgraded to Super T Fork, MRP, Hope Brakes, Romic shock with red spring, TruVativ bar, otherwise stock;

2002 small Stinky Primo - Red Z1 fork, Fox shock, black XC rims, XT Brakes (6 in. rotors), XT cranks;

1993 Litespeed Ocoee - 1" steerer tube, Marz. MX Comp fork, specialized cranks, profile stem, flat handle bar;

If anybody sees any of these bikes for sale or even thinks they might see them, please let me know. I can't even express how much this sucks . . ."
